The table below provides a comprehensive list of courses offered by Shri Balram Singh Mahavidyalaya Kaushambi Fee Structure, including total fees, year-wise breakdown, and eligibility criteria:
Course Name | Duration | Total Fees (INR) | Year-wise Fees (INR) | Eligibility Criteria |
Bachelor of Education (B.Ed) | 2 Years | ₹50,000 | ₹25,000 per year | Candidate must have passed 10+2 or equivalent examination from a recognized school/board. |
Bachelor of Arts (B.A) | 3 Years | ₹40,000 | ₹13,333 per year | Candidate must have passed 10+2 or equivalent examination from a recognized school/board. |
Bachelor of Science (B.Sc) | 3 Years | ₹45,000 | ₹15,000 per year | Candidate must have passed 10+2 or equivalent examination from a recognized school/board. |
Master of Arts (M.A) | 2 Years | ₹30,000 | ₹15,000 per year | Graduation in any stream from a recognized university. |
Master of Science (M.Sc) | 2 Years | ₹35,000 | ₹17,500 per year | Graduation in Science from a recognized university. |
